Title: Innovations of Markus Keller
Introduction
Markus Keller is a notable inventor based in Leonberg, Germany. He has made significant contributions to the automotive industry, holding a total of nine patents. His work focuses on enhancing vehicle performance and efficiency through innovative designs.
Latest Patents
One of his latest patents is a rear diffusor unit with a flow-directing sealing element. This invention includes a base element designed to be mounted in a fixed position on a vehicle's body, a movable diffusor element, and a drive device that allows the diffusor element to move relative to the base element between two end positions. The diffusor element is a box diffusor with two fixed side walls, a fixed rear wall, and a fixed base. Another significant patent is a multi-part air duct for a motor vehicle, which consists of a lower foam part, an upper foam part, and lateral injection moldings that connect the two foam parts on both sides.
